About This Feature

Overview

AMORLINC is a financial function in WPS Spreadsheet for Windows. It is used to calculate asset depreciation for each accounting period with a linear depreciation method. When you type the function name, the editing area can show syntax guidance so you can check the parameter order and input format more easily.

Core capabilities include:

  • Type AMORLINC( to view syntax guidance and confirm the function structure.
  • Enter parameters in a cell and return a depreciation result.
  • Use cell references or cross-sheet references in the formula.
  • Recalculate results after referenced data changes.

This function is useful for fixed-asset depreciation estimates, finance worksheets, training, and formula practice.
